Journey went into CBS Studios in November 1974 with producer Roy Halee to file its debut album, Journey. The album was released in April 1975, getting into the Billboard charts at range 138. Rhythm guitarist Tickner left the band (along with the music enterprise to check medicine) on account of the level of large touring the band was accomplishing in selling the album, allowing Schon to take on whole guitar obligations.
